Landing Page Development in Giza

Landing page development in Giza has a specific failure mode. The advertisement is targeted at Greater Cairo, the page says Giza, and the visitor decides in two seconds that this business is somewhere else.

Working in this market

The mismatch that costs the most

An advertisement reaches somebody in Zamalek or Maadi. They tap it. The page opens with a Giza address at the top, and they leave before reading the offer, because they have concluded it is not for them.

Nothing was wrong with the advertisement or the offer.

Why this happens so often here

Because the targeting is drawn on a map and the page is written from a business registration. The advertisement thinks in radius and the page thinks in governorate, and nobody reconciles the two.

The page has to answer the geography the advertisement created.

What the page says instead

It leads with who it serves, not where it is filed.

  • The areas actually covered, named the way customers name them
  • Delivery or visit time from the customer's side, not distance from yours
  • The formal address further down, where it reassures rather than filters
  • One clear action, reachable without scrolling

Matching the page to the advertisement it came from

If the advertisement promised a price, the price appears immediately. If it named an area, that area is named on the page. A visitor who cannot find what they were promised assumes they clicked the wrong thing.

Why one page per campaign, not one page for all of them

Because a page trying to serve three different offers persuades nobody. Separate pages also make it possible to tell which offer worked, which a shared page never does.

The speed requirement is harsher here

Paid traffic is bought, so every second of load time is money already spent and thrown away. A landing page carries no framework it does not need and no image it did not resize.

Three seconds on a phone in traffic is the working target.

The form, and why it is shorter than the client wants

Every field costs completions. Name and phone number is usually the whole form, and the rest of the qualification happens in the follow up conversation where it is cheaper.

Why the messaging button matters as much as the form

Many people will not fill a form and will happily send a message. With around 57.2 million Messenger users in Egypt and WhatsApp at roughly 72 per cent of internet users, the message is not a fallback, it is the main path for a large share of visitors.

What has to be on the page for a cold visitor

Somebody who has never heard of the business needs reasons to believe it exists properly.

  • A real photograph of the premises or the work
  • A phone number that is answered during the hours stated
  • Prices or a range, because the alternative is an unanswered question
  • One piece of evidence, such as a review or a named client

Landing pages in Arabic

Arabic leads for almost all consumer campaigns in Greater Cairo, and the page is written in Arabic rather than translated. English pages exist where the campaign genuinely targets an English speaking audience.

What gets tested first

The headline and the offer, one at a time, because they move results more than layout does. Colour and button changes are tested last, if at all.

What Wink does not do

Send paid traffic to a homepage. A homepage answers ten questions and the advertisement asked one, and the visitor is left to find their own way to it.
